I have listed the specs and details on everything below. Speakers The M3 proprietary design utilizes a 3 way idea. By incorporating dual 6.5" mids crossed at the proper frequency, the Titanium horn driver has less pressure on it. This allows it to handle more power and sound more pleasing or ambient. My utilizing mids, the boxy top end frequencies are rolled off of the woofers for a much more natural accurate response. The concept of the M series speakers is geared for high power, abusive applications such as large concert venues. However, there has been NO sacrifice in sound quality to achieve that performance level. So even being used as small venue speakers, at close range you'll experience linear response from top to bottom. The M3 speakers are loaded with professional grade drivers. Featuring a woofer with a 4” copper clad aluminum voice coil, 100oz. magnet and a cast aluminum basket, dual 6.5" mids and a titanium horn driver that has a 2” diaphragm and 30oz. magnet with a 1” throat on an 8.5” x 16” smooth frequency, wide throw, bolt on style horn lens. These drivers are matched with a 12/18db per octave high power crossover that utilizes dual glass bulb tweeter protection. Mylar capacitors and high power chokes are used for minimal high power saturation. The design of the M series speakers is such that all frequencies are prevalent without coloring. This allows the user to be able to EQ his/her desired sound. As the saying goes, you can always EQ out what you don't want but you can never add what doesn't exist. Contrary to popular understanding, there is a lot more involved and major differences in PA speakers from one line to the next. First of all, ALL professional grade speakers use hardwood for the construction like the Madison M series speakers which are made out of 3/4” 13ply Birch and are braced on every panel internally for maximum strength. Hardwood is much stronger and half the weight of Particle board or MDF, both of which are simply low budget materials.
